#9086 obsolete Problem ejecting CD/DVD gojkok
Description

Host: SuseLinux 11.4 Guest: Windows 7 (64-bit) VirtualBox: 4.0.8 GuestAdd: 4.0.8

The CD/DVD "Passthrough" option is enabled. When I insert disk into Windows 7, and press eject button on CD/DVD device, everything working perfectly. After that I again insert disk and open disk inside Windows 7 to see content on the disk. After that when I press eject on CD/DVD device, nothing happens, not even green lamp on device blink. I try software eject from Win... right click->eject... nothing. I minimise virtualbox, go to suse Mycomputer, eject, and that is working.

#9089 obsolete Spaces in ISO name Mike McClanahan
Description

Had all kinds of problems install ISO image until I figured out that it would not accept a space in the iso image filename. That was why it would not accept the downloaded MS ISO images. Replaced spaces with underlines and image loaded fine.

#9091 obsolete VM is inaccessible Alex Banha
Description

The VM is alive (I can ping it) but cannot access any service: HTTP, SSH, SMTP, anything

It happens with version 4.0.8. It also happened with previous versions: 4.0.2 and 4.0.4, but with 4.0.8 it is worse. I can´t remember if it happened with 3.2.8.

HOST: Linux Slackware current 2.6.38.7 (64 bits) Guest: Linux Slackware current 2.6.38.7 (64 bits)

I can't find any trace of a problem in any log file, neither in the host nor the guest. The guest stops registering MARKs in the /var/log/messages. The host stops writing events in the VM log file until I destroy the VM.

I have 5 VMs in a Intel i7 processor with 12GB of RAM, and they hang randomly. The VDI files are stored in a Linux RAID1.

Originally the VMs were created in version 3.2.8 and upgraded until 4.0.8. Because of the random hangs, I decided to build the 5 VMs from scratch in the 4.0.8 version. The problem remains, they still hang randomly.
